IDRÎSÎ CHOIR SCHOOL

Sign-up open until February 15th

Learn medieval and Mediterranean vocal traditions in twice-monthly classes, from Old Roman chant and Hildegard von Bingen to Corsican, Greek, and Armenian repertoires. You’ll work directly with ensemble director Thomas Fournil, alongside rotating guest teachers from Idrîsî Ensemble, with a focus on early notation, ornamentation, and polyphony.
